Hacker News new | ask | show | jobs
by svict4 2711 days ago
So you should always play to the skills in your team, agreed. But in this case, it gives consistency across Government. If your Department/Agency is rolling their own components, why not add them back into the Design System for others to use? Less repeated effort, cheaper for the tax payer.
1 comments

I would like to, but they are too tightly coupled to our stack.
Right, so there's probably a discussion that needs to be had with your enterprise architecture team on why said stack was used (irrespective of skill sets available) when certain features are available "for free" (e.g. the DesignSystem)

I'll have a wild stab in the dark in saying that if the stack is really tightly coupled, that there's extra labour required by the dev team to meet the Digital Service Standard. Which is, really speaking, unnecessary public expenditure.

You are preaching to the choir here mate. Keep in mind we have over 60 developers, and over 100 single page applications under development/support.

The frameworks we are using have been in use here since 2014 (pre-dating the DesignSystem). It is not an easy matter to switch over to these components, especially considering the only framework supported is React.

As far as unnecessary public expenditure... I could probably write 1000 pages on it and not make a dent.